Workshop and talk
Every year, RUFA welcomes artists, designers, filmmakers, architects, photographers, communication professionals, curators, entrepreneurs and leading figures from the Italian and international cultural scene. Talks are in-person events held in the Aula Magna, during which a guest speaker shares their career path, research and professional experience. Students are encouraged to participate, ask questions and engage directly with established professionals.
Workshops are intensive, week-long laboratories. Guided by lecturers and professionals, students work on briefs and tangible projects, experimenting with contemporary methodologies, languages and processes. During the academic year, RUFA organises three Workshop sessions, each offering a wide range of laboratories from which students can choose.
This programme of activities complements the academic journey by encouraging the exchange of ideas and cross-disciplinary collaboration. It is an opportunity to build new connections within the RUFA community.
